Course details

• Edge Computing for Sustainable Transportation: An Overview
This unit provides an introduction to edge computing, its applications, and benefits in the context of sustainable transportation. It covers the fundamentals of edge computing, including its architecture, key components, and use cases. • IoT and Edge Computing for Smart Traffic Management
This unit explores the role of IoT devices and edge computing in optimizing traffic flow, reducing congestion, and improving air quality. It discusses the use of edge computing in processing and analyzing real-time traffic data. • Edge AI for Autonomous Vehicles
This unit delves into the application of edge AI in autonomous vehicles, focusing on the processing and analysis of sensor data at the edge. It covers the key technologies and techniques used in edge AI for autonomous vehicles. • Edge Computing for Electric Vehicle Charging Infrastructure
This unit examines the use of edge computing in optimizing electric vehicle charging infrastructure, including the management of charging stations, energy storage, and grid integration. • Sustainable Transportation Systems: A Holistic Approach
This unit takes a holistic approach to sustainable transportation systems, covering the integration of edge computing, IoT, and other technologies to create a comprehensive and efficient transportation network. • Edge Computing for Smart Cities: A Case Study
This unit presents a case study on the implementation of edge computing in a smart city, highlighting the benefits and challenges of integrating edge computing with other smart city technologies. • Cybersecurity in Edge Computing for Sustainable Transportation
This unit focuses on the cybersecurity aspects of edge computing in sustainable transportation, including the risks and threats associated with edge computing and strategies for mitigating them. • Edge Computing for Energy Efficiency in Transportation
This unit explores the use of edge computing in optimizing energy efficiency in transportation, including the management of energy consumption, renewable energy integration, and grid resilience. • Edge AI for Predictive Maintenance in Transportation
This unit examines the application of edge AI in predictive maintenance for transportation systems, including the use of sensor data and machine learning algorithms to predict equipment failures and optimize maintenance schedules. • Edge Computing for Sustainable Mobility Services
This unit discusses the use of edge computing in sustainable mobility services, including the development of mobility-as-a-service (MaaS) platforms, ride-hailing services, and public transportation systems.

Career path

**Edge Computing Professional** Design, develop, and deploy edge computing systems for real-time data processing and analytics in sustainable transportation.
**Sustainable Transportation Engineer** Develop and implement sustainable transportation systems, including electric vehicles, public transit, and non-motorized transportation, using edge computing technologies.
**Data Scientist (Edge Computing)** Apply machine learning and data analytics techniques to edge computing systems in sustainable transportation, ensuring efficient data processing and decision-making.
**Cloud Architect (Edge Computing)** Design and deploy cloud-based edge computing systems for sustainable transportation, ensuring scalability, security, and reliability.
**IT Project Manager (Edge Computing)** Oversee the planning, execution, and delivery of edge computing projects in sustainable transportation, ensuring timely and within-budget completion.
